Dates of planting flower seedlings in February

For a lush, blooming flower bed, many annuals are also best planted in seedlings rather than seeds. In February, there are three options for planting annuals:

  • February 3-6;
  • February 13-15;
  • February 21-23.

These days are most favorable for sowing seeds of petunia, marigolds, lobelia, cornflower, etc.
